Sonogram Tech Occupation Description

Elmont NY sonographer testing pregnant womanThere are several acceptable tit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also referred to as ultrasound technologists, sonogram techs, and di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ers). Regardless of name, they all have the same primary job function, which is to carry out diagnostic ultrasound testing on patients. Even though many work as generalists there are specializations within the field, for example in cardiology and pediatrics. The majority practice in Elmont NY clinics, hospitals, outpatient diagnostic imaging centers and even private practices. Typical daily job tasks of an ultrasound tech may involve:

  • Preserving records of patient medical histories and details of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Readying the ultrasound machines for usage and then cleaning and re-calibrating them
  • Moving patients to treatment rooms and ensuring their comfort
  • Operating equipment while minimizing patient exposure to sound waves
  • Reviewing the results and determining necessity for supplemental testing

Sonographers must routinely gauge the performance and safety of their equipment. They also are held to a high ethical standard and code of conduct as medical practitioners. In order to maintain that level of professionalism and remain current with medical knowledge, they are mandated to complete continuing education programs on a regular basis.

Sonogram Tech Degrees Available

Elmont NY ultrasound tech testing pregnant womanUltrasound technician enrollees have the opportunity to earn either an Associate Degree or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will usually take around 18 months to 2 years to accomplish dependent on the course load and program. A Bachelor’s Degree will take longer at as long as four years to complete. Another alternative for those who have previously received a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have obtained a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a relevant medical field, you can instead choose a certificate program that will require only 12 to 18 months to complete. One thing to keep in mind is that the majority of sonographer schools do have a practical training component as a portion of their curriculum. It can often be fulfilled by entering into an internship program which numerous schools set up through Elmont NY clinics and hospitals. Once you have graduated from one of the degree or certificate programs, you will then have to fulfill the licensing or certification requirements in New York or whatever state you decide to work in.

Are the Ultrasound Technician Schools Accredited? A large number of ultrasound technician colleges have obtained some type of accreditation, whether regional or national. However, it’s still imperative to make sure that the program and school are accredited. One of the most highly respected accrediting organizations in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Programs obtaining accreditation from the JRC-DMS have gone through a rigorous evaluation of their teachers and course materials. If the program is online it can also obtain acc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ets distance or online education. All accrediting organizations should be acknowledged by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Besides ensuring a superior education, accreditation will also assist in getting financial assistance and student loans, which are often not offered for non-accredited colleges. Accreditation may also be a pre-requisite for certification and licensing as required. And many Elmont NY employers will only hire a graduate of an accredited program for entry-level jobs.

Elmont, New York

Elmont is an unincorporated community and census-designated place (CDP) located in northwestern Hempstead in Nassau County, New York, United States, along its border with the borough of Queens in New York City. It is a suburban bedroom community located on Long Island. The population was 33,198 at the 2010 census.

In 1650, Christopher and Thomas Foster purchased a large plot of land. The Foster's land was controlled by Dutch settlers from the Holy Roman Empire, under the Habsburg Dynasty-House of Lorraine (1524). The Foster's were intended to raise cattle, and sheep on their newly settled land, the Hempstead Plains of Long Island. They named this place "Foster's Meadow"—a name which would remain for the next 200 years of the village's history.

By the mid-17th century, ethnic descendants of Sephardi Jews were settling on the Hempstead Plains for Agriculture. Control of the Dutch colony of New Amsterdam shifted to England in 1664. This marked the first gradual cultural shift in Foster's Meadow with the establishment of a community of predominantly English Protestant farmers, and their families. In 1683, Long Island was divided into three counties, Kings, Queens, and Suffolk County. Under this new structure, Foster's Meadow was originally part of Queens County. During 1790 George Washington passed through the town while touring to the East on Long Island. The current boundaries of Elmont were decided upon in 1898; at this point, Nassau County was erected, leading to conflict over land, and monies owed as a result of Elmont's boundary shift from Queens.

It was during the mid-19th century, that Foster's Meadow experienced its second cultural shift. There was an influx of Roman Catholic, and Ashkenazi Jewish agricultural farmers from Brooklyn, and Middle Village to the West. These ethnic groups were largely of German, and Italian descent practicing both Roman Catholicism, and Judaism. Indeed, the Catholic population in Foster's Meadow grew to an extent. The Church of the Nativity of Our Lord Jesus Christ, was built during the Wittelsbach Dynasty in 1852. The Roman Catholic Church was re-dedicated Saint Boniface Roman Catholic Parish, in honor of the Patron Saint of Germany in 1857. The Parish was providing a focal point for the gradual development of a Catholic population base. Rev. Peter Hartraub was essentially the founding pastor, and appointed the first resident pastor of Foster's Meadow in 1858. Rev. Peter Hartraub built a new rectory, and in 1887 a new school with four classrooms on the first floor, and an auditorium on the second. The Dominican Sisters were invited to teach in the Catholic School, and they built a Convent on parish land donated to them.

Ultrasound technician colleges require that you have earned a high school diploma or a GED. Along with meeting academic standards, you need to be in at least reasonably good physical health, able to stand for extended time frames and able to regularly lift weights of 50 pounds or more, as is it often necessary to adjust patients and move heavy machinery. Other beneficial talents include technical proficiency, the ability to keep collected when confronted by an anxious or angry patient and the ability to communicate in a clear and compassionate manner.
